On-the-job paid training and ongoing development Commitment to safe work environments Health, Dental and Vision insurance available at competitive rates Paid vacation 401K benefits package Opportunities for paid travel Diverse and inclusive employer committed to your success WIS Field Training Supervisor Job Preview The Field Training Supervisor is a people leader who will be an essential part of the team within their assigned group of Districts in a designated geography.
The Field Training Supervisor is responsible for the successful execution of recruiting, hiring, onboarding, training, developing and retaining employees.
The Field Training Supervisor will report to the Regional Talent Manager and work hand in hand with District Managers to ensure associate readiness for upcoming business needs.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
